Fashion drawing in archival ink. Drawn on nice crosshatched coloured drawing paper. Kind of in reference to Jim Morrison lyrics. I hope people can feel the lines precision and graceful 1st attempt ink moving at fluid speeds. American Poet, Indie American and Lana inspired. Signed.

Mexican-American Pictorial Artista, Poet & Philosopher in and of Life + Death evermore. Born in Colima, Colima México in 1986. Was imported into America in and around the timing of Dalí's Death. A prime Surrealist at heart, a classicist waveform apart. Writing mythopoesia and engaging Painting & Drawing at its core and atavistic values. Exploring and expanding the frequencies of the quintessential line and pictorial movements cast in time past and crossing them over into the 21st Century, possibly single-handedly, to provide the coming epochs with a time-testing eclectic document into the times of future past.
